So I spent the day yesterday rebuilding after my tail blew up last week. Last week I had installed the all metal tail (case, grips, slider, lever), and one of the grips blew apart as soon as I hit idle up, pretty much ending my 500 flights for the day. When I rebuilt yesterday, I went back to the plastic slider, and also left out the shim between the main and thrust bearings. This provided a little bit of play and it seems to have worked. My experience shows more tail resonance issues at speeds where the 12 will run. Just a heads up. Notice the manual shows all idle ups at 100% on the 13.... almost an admission of a knowen issue IMHO.
The ESC maxes out at 70%, so there is no difference between a 70% throttle and a 100% throttle. I posted this somewhere in the forum already.

Notice the "normal" curves in the manuals peak at 60%. That is already 60/70 =85% of the throttle max.
